Freelance Designer

This may seem a little silly, but what exactly is a Freelance Designer/Web Designer/Programmer etc..
I know that Freelancing generally means to lock into a very long term employment with the one person or boss (or something like that).

Does it man that the designer/programmer etc, works just for themselves instead of being employed?

Freelance does not mean being locked in for a long time - just the opposite. It means they work on a contractual basis. Contracts can be one week or three years. You are a hired specialist that is not part of the regular staff.

I heard it best described this way. You are freelance even if you are 100% self employed and working full time until you hire a full time employee. So when your business grows to more than just you, then you are technically not freelance. I really like the description/definition as it adds a bit more regarding the business side of things too.

I prefer the word "sub-contractor". A lot of the companies I sub-contract to have their own Webmonkies. The problem is 99% of the webmonkies companies hire just can't do the job (job=goals and objectives - not the site look).

I usually lay it on the line "authority must be commensurate with accountability".

In other words, if I don't meet your goals (and I have the authority to do what I need to), fire me. If your goals are not met because your inhouse marketing expert is a moron - fire him. If I met your goals, I'm going to want a raise next contract.....lol.

Most of my work comes from companies that have a beautiful looking site that just doesn't do anything. So the first question I ask the CEO is, if I put up a one blank page and it triples your leads, do you care?
